5

我对内部分发和临时分发感到困惑。

  1. 内部和临时分发应用程序是否需要让苹果审查团队审查?

  2. 内部分发和临时分发有什么区别?

  3. 创建内部应用程序证书和分发流程的任何示例/指南?

  4. 内部分发是否需要收集用户 UDID 来配置?

  5. 如果我开始使用内部/临时分发来分发“A”应用程序,我可以稍后将“A”应用程序分发到 App Store 吗?

4

2 回答 2

3
  1. 不,他们没有。
  2. 通过内部分发,您可以在公司员工使用的任何 iOS 设备上安装该应用程序,而无需设备的 UDID。Ad-Hoc 用于在选定数量的设备上测试应用程序(每个帐户每年 100 个唯一设备)。
  3. 是的,请参阅 Apple iOS 开发者企业计划
  4. 不,内部分布式应用程序没有任何 UDID 限制。
  5. 可以,但您需要进入 AppStore 开发者计划,而不是用于内部分发的企业版。
于 2012-10-24T10:29:28.527 回答
0

Ad Hoc Distribution 授权一组有限的设备运行您的应用程序

加入标准计划的 iOS 开发者还可以在 App Store 之外分发应用程序到多达 100 台不同的设备上,仅用于测试目的。要使用临时分发,请为您的应用创建一个存档,或让团队成员向您发送存档应用的 iOS 应用商店包 (.ipa)。

您通过提供 .ipa 文件来分发您的应用程序,供用户安装在他们的设备上。由于您选择了有效的临时配置文件来存档应用程序,因此用户无需在其设备上安装配置文件,只需 .ipa 文件即可。用户可以使用 iTunes 在他们的设备上安装该应用程序。如果用户想使用 Xcode 在他们的设备上安装应用程序,请将存档共享为 .xcarchive 文件包。

内部分发允许公司在内部分发应用程序 注册企业计划的 iOS 开发人员可以在内部分发,而无需识别单个设备或使用 App Store。要在内部分发您的应用程序,请创建您的应用程序存档,或让队友向您发送存档的应用程序。使用您公司的授权软件分发机制分发您的内部应用程序。由于应用程序文件可以安装在任何 iOS 设备上,因此请确保保护此文件的分发。您公司的成员可以使用 iTunes、iPhone 配置实用程序或 Xcode 在他们的设备上安装该应用程序。

于 2012-10-24T10:37:41.610 回答